Seven Things You Might Not Know About Miss Riki
- I LOVE karaoke! I just cannot get enough of it! My only gripe is that karaoke is a strictly after-hours affair, so I end up staying out much too late when I participate.
- I have four tattoos. No, that’s not excessive or even more than normal in today’s culture, but they each mean something to me and celebrate things that bring me joy.
- I am obsessed with Scrabble. I play on every electronic device I own, as well as an old-fashioned board. Watch out; I am quite competitive!
- I am studying English Literature and Linguistics. I know I have mentioned that I am a University student before, but never what my course of study is.
- I love to bake. This must be clarified by the fact that I hate to cook. However, if the recipe involves sugar, flour and eggs and produces a sweet confection; I’m all for it!
- I collect favorite words. I got his idea from a book I read long ago and have since forgotten and have been keeping a list of favorite words ever since. Most are English, some are French, and there are a few that I dreamt up myself.
- I love self-help books. I am a sucker for a book cover that promises to make me look better, feel better, or have better relationships. It’s crazy how much nonsense is published under the guise of being helpful, but I have actually garnered some pretty awesome advice along the way.
